Question 264089: A rectangle has a perimeter of 15.4cm and an area of 14.4cm squared. Find the dimensions of the rectangle?

Length + width is 7.7 cm
If length is X, width is 7.7 - X
Area is thus X(7.7 - X) = 14.4
-X^2 + 7.7X - 14.4 = 0 change signs
X^2 - 7.7X + 14.4 = 0
X =( 7.7 + sqrt( 7.7^2 - 4x14.4))/2
X = (7.7 + 1.3)/2 and (7.7 - 1.3)/2
X= 9/2 and 6.4/2
X= 4.5 and 3.2 cm
